Step 2: Meet Basic Educational Requirements
Most online dental assistant programs require applicants to have:
- High school diploma or GED equivalent
- Basic computer literacy
- Some programs may ask for prior healthcare experience or prerequisites

Step 4: Complete The Online Coursework
The coursework typically combines theoretical knowledge and practical skills through virtual labs, simulations, and assignments. Key topics include:
- Dental anatomy and physiology
- Infection control and safety protocols
- Dental radiography (X-ray techniques)
- Assisting with procedures and patient management
- Dental office administration
Step 5: Gain Practical Experience
Even though online courses drive the theoretical learning, practical experience is vital. Many programs incorporate externships or clinical rotations at dental offices. Some tips include:
- look for programs that offer externship coordination assistance
- Reach out to local dental clinics for volunteer or shadowing opportunities
- Ensure hands-on training covers real-world scenarios
Step 6: Obtain Certification or Licensing
Certification requirements for dental assistants vary by state or country. Generally, you will need to pass a certification exam, such as the Dental Assisting National board (DANB) Certified Dental Assistant (CDA).
| Certification | Requirements | Validity |
|---|---|---|
| DANB CDA | Education + Exam | 5 years,renewable |
| State Licensure | Varies by state | Frequently enough 1-3 years |
